Judge Pokorny Inducted into NONOSO

The Hon. Sally D. Pokorny, District Court Judge for the Kansas 7th Judicial District was recently inducted into NONOSO.

NONOSO is an alumnae women's honor society at Washburn University taken from Washburn's motto, Non nobis solum, or “not for ourselves alone”. The organization recognizes exceptional Washburn women based on their intelligence, creativity, personality, scholarship, leadership, moral integrity, community involvement and accomplishment.  A formal ceremony will take place on April 9th at Washburn.

 Judge Pokorny was a former Montgomery County Attorney, Cherryvale City Attorney and General Practitioner in South East Kansas for 25 years prior to moving to Lawrence.
